Greyhound Canada announced today it’s ending their passenger bus and freight services in Manitoba, Alberta, and Saskatchewan and cancelling all but one route in B.C.

They are blaming a 41 per cent decline in ridership since 2010 along with competition from subsidized national and inter-regional passenger transportation services, regulatory constraints, the continued growth of car ownership and growth of new low-cost airlines.

The cancellations are scheduled to take effect Oct. 31.
